Will be nice to see them and Leeds face off in the top flight again. https://www.sportsnet.ca/soccer/article/nottingham-forest-promoted-to-premier-league-for-first-time-since-1999/ Nottingham Forest promoted to Premier League for first time since 1999 Sportsnet Staff@SportsnetMay 29, 2022, 1:25 PM 0 After 23 years outside English football's top flight, Nottingham Forest will be playing in the Premier League. Forest defeated Huddersfield Town 1-0 in Sunday's promotion playoff final at Wembley Stadium and will be part of the 2022-23 Premier League season as a result. A Levi Colwill own goal via a James Garner pass into the box in the 43rd minute was the difference for Forest. That means Canadian international Richie Laryea could be playing in the Premier League next season, mere months after joining Forest from Toronto FC in January. Mj2345 Posted June 23, 2022 Share Posted June 23, 2022 https://soccer.realgm.com/wiretap/10046/Bayern-Signs-Sadio-Mane-From-Liverpool-For-$43M Bayern Munich have signed Saido Mane from Liverpool on a $42.9 million transfer. The future of Mane at Liverpool has been in doubt since the club signed Darwin Nunez from Benfica. Mane joined Liverpool from Southampton in 2016, arriving within the first 12 months of manager Jurgen Klopp's reign, and played a crucial role at the club. UnkNuk Posted July 29, 2022 Share Posted July 29, 2022 The English Premier League starts its season on August 5 with Arsenal hosting Crystal Palace. For the last several seasons streaming service DAZN has had the Canadian broadcasting rights to the EPL. That's changed. fubo, another sports streaming service, has won the Canadian rights to the EPL for the upcoming season and the next few seasons after that. Apparently they've been getting pretty good crowds for the tournament and they're expecting a big crowd again tomorrow at Wembley: A record-breaking final for a record-breaking tournament Several attendance records have been smashed during UEFA Women's EURO 2022 and another landmark was reached following the semi-final between Germany and France. The overall tournament attendance record of 240,055 set at Women's EURO 2017 in the Netherlands has now been doubled, with last night's match bringing the total attendance of this tournament to 487,683. https://www.uefa.com/womenseuro/news/0277-15bb88da6685-12ddcd11e281-1000--a-record-breaking-final-for-a-record-breaking-tournament/?utm_campaign=weuro&utm_content=editorial&utm_medium=email&utm_source=rec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
